What are typical daily responsibilities for a Labview Developer?

Labview Developers typically spend their days designing, developing, and debugging LabVIEW-based test, measurement, or control systems. Responsibilities often include writing custom code, integrating hardware devices, conducting hardware-in-the-loop simulations, and troubleshooting system performance. Collaboration with engineers, scientists, and technicians is common to ensure system requirements are met and project timelines are maintained. Additionally, Labview Developers may create documentation, participate in project meetings, and support system installations or upgrades as needed.

What is a LabVIEW Developer job?

A LabVIEW Developer is a professional who designs, develops, and maintains applications using LabVIEW, a graphical programming language by National Instruments. They typically work in automation, test and measurement, data acquisition, or control system development. Their responsibilities include creating software architectures, integrating hardware components, debugging, and optimizing performance. LabVIEW Developers often work in industries such as manufacturing, aerospace, electronics, and research. Strong knowledge of LabVIEW, NI hardware, and engineering principles is ess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Labview Developer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Labview Developer, strong proficiency in LabVIEW programming, experience with test automation, and a background in electrical or computer engineering are essential. Familiarity with National Instruments (NI) hardware, Certified LabVIEW Developer (CLD) or Certified LabVIEW Architect (CLA) credentials, and hands-on work with DAQ systems are typically required. Excellent probl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help Labview Developers excel in diverse technical teams. Mastery of these skills enables precise system design, accurate data acquisition, and successful collaboration on complex engineering projects.

Job Summary
The Experienced Mechanical Engineer - Dynamic and Acoustics works under limited supervision and performs moderately complex, critical technical functions to execute BPMI's mission, with a primary focus on turbines and generators. Responsibilities include evaluating analysis and test data of rotating machinery to make engineering decisions and recommendations; performing rotodynamic analysis; conducting data analysis and signal processing on rotating machinery test data; and performing performance evaluations of rotating machinery to assess and optimize operating characteristics. This position requires knowledge and application of mechanical engineering principles, rotordynamics, vibration analysis, and data analysis techniques as applied to complex rotating equipment.

Bechtel Plant Machinery, Inc. (BPMI) is a prime contractor for the Naval Nuclear Propulsion Program (NNPP). BPMI is involved in the design, purchase, quality control, and delivery of major propulsion plant components for installation in nuclear-powered aircraft carriers, submarines, and prototype plants for the U.S. Navy.
